It turns out you’ve got a conflict with the Corvallis Indoor Park job that you signed up for. Here are your options for how to take care of your responsibility.
1. TRADE. Find another Park member to trade with you. We suggest that you get the names and numbers of a couple other parents or caregivers who you see at the Park regularly — before you need to trade.
2. HAVE SOMEONE ELSE DO IT FOR YOU. Ask an adult friend or family member to take the job for you. While we don’t actively promote having someone who is unfamiliar with the Park take on a job, this option is better than missing your job. Anyone who does your job for you must be 18 years or older or be with an adult 18 or older.
If your job is park closing or vacuuming, there will usually be at least one other volunteer present, as well as written instructions on the bulletin board above the cubbies. If your job is toy cleaning, there will be a toy cleaning manager present to show people what to do.
If you ask a non-member to take your job, remember that YOU are responsible for their actions. Remind them to be quiet and respectful of Corvallis Indoor Park and our church host’s property.
3. PAY A SUBSTITUTE. You can pay another member to take your job. The rate is $10 for park closing and vacuuming or $20 for toy cleaning. We maintain lists of people who are willing to do both types of jobs and they will be available here shortly after 2018 registration ends.
We ask that you arrange to pay your substitute in advance. You can do this in person or via an online service like PayPal.com. (If you use a credit card via PayPal, you may have to pay slightly more to cover any fees.) The Park is not responsible for problems that arise between members regarding job substitutions and payment.
